Horizontal Directional Drilling (HDD) is a well-liked approach Utilized in the development and utility industries for putting in underground pipes, cables, together with other infrastructure. This trenchless technological know-how is recognized for its effectiveness and small disruption into the bordering environment. With HDD, there's no need to have for big-scale excavation or open trenches, which might trigger significant disturbances to both equally the normal landscape and urban environments. As a result, HDD has become the go-to Resolution For several initiatives, Primarily All those in regions where regular digging techniques might be impractical or pricey.
With regards to HDD, there are several indicators you need to know to ensure its prosperous software. The first step in the method consists of drilling a pilot gap, which serves as being a tutorial For the remainder of the Procedure. The pilot hole is drilled horizontally, subsequent a pre-decided route that avoids road blocks like present utilities along with other underground constructions. The subsequent phase will involve reaming, exactly where the hole is slowly enlarged into the required diameter. Lastly, the pipe or cable is pulled throughout the recently shaped hole. This process can be used for numerous varieties of infrastructure, like drinking water lines, sewage pipes, electrical cables, and even more.

Certainly one of the simplest methods for optimizing Horizontal Directional Drilling is the usage of mud motors, which help to propel the drill bit ahead. The mud motor is run by drilling fluid, that is pumped down the drill string to cool the little bit and maintain strain. This fluid also can help to remove debris through the borehole, making sure that the drill can proceed transferring effortlessly. By managing the flow charge and force of your drilling fluid, operators can preserve the required stability involving the drive needed to shift the drill little bit and the necessity to minimize environmental influence.

In addition there are several variables to contemplate when determining whether or not Horizontal Directional Drilling is the appropriate choice for a particular career. As an example, when HDD is very efficient in lots of predicaments, it may not be appropriate for all sorts of terrain. Really hard rock formations, for instance, can pose considerable issues, because they involve more potent tools and may raise the possibility of kit failure. Likewise, in parts using a higher density of existing utilities, the risk of harming these buildings is often elevated, which could end in high-priced repairs and delays.

Amongst the most important elements of Horizontal Directional Drilling is its minimal environmental impact. Because there isn't any require for giant-scale excavation, the floor space afflicted with the undertaking is stored to a minimum amount. This is particularly advantageous in environmentally delicate regions, including wetlands, parks, or city environments. The opportunity to drill without having disrupting the area allows for a lot quicker undertaking completion, decreased restoration prices, and less disturbance to local wildlife.
Not all components of Horizontal Directional Drilling are easy, nevertheless. There are some unfamiliar facts about the method that many contractors and engineers don’t constantly consider. By way of example, the type of soil can drastically effects the drilling method. Sure kinds of soil, for instance clay or shale, can be harder to drill by, demanding specialised gear and additional time. Likewise, the existence of groundwater can complicate the Procedure, as drinking water can seep into your borehole and affect the drilling fluid’s efficiency.
